What is Double Glazing?

Double glazing is a window fitters luton style that features 2 panes of glass separated by a layer of air or gas. This configuration offers superior insulation compared to single-pane windows, resulting in a series of benefits for property owners. The air or gas in between the panes acts as a barrier, minimizing heat transfer and sound penetration. This innovation has been extensively embraced in the UK, and Luton is no exception.

Advantages of Double Glazing in Luton

  1. Energy Efficiency

    • Decreased Heating Bills: Double glazing helps retain heat in the home during colder months, decreasing the requirement for excessive heating. This can cause considerable cost savings on energy expenses.
    • Lower Carbon Footprint: By lowering energy intake, double glazing contributes to a more sustainable and eco-friendly living environment.
  2. Sound Reduction

    • Quieter Home: The insulating layer in between the panes of glass successfully shuts out external noise, producing a more tranquil and comfy living area.
  3. Improved Security

    • Enhanced Safety: Double-glazed windows are more safe and secure than single-pane windows and doors luton, as they are harder to break. This added layer of security can provide comfort for homeowners.
  4. Increased Property Value

    • Higher Resale Value: Installing double glazing can increase the value of your residential or commercial property, making it a worthwhile investment for those considering future sales.
  5. Lowered Condensation

    • Less Moisture: Double glazing helps in reducing condensation on window surfaces, which can avoid mold and mildew development, maintaining a healthier living environment.

Factors to consider Before Installation

  1. Expense

    • Initial Investment: While the long-term advantages of double glazing are significant, the preliminary expense can be a consideration. Homeowners must look into different suppliers and get multiple quotes to discover the finest worth.
    • Financing Options: Some business offer financing choices to make the setup more affordable. It's worth checking out these options to find a payment plan that fits your budget plan.
  2. Quality of Installation

    • Professional Installation: Ensuring that the double glazing is set up by an expert is important. Poor installation can cause problems such as air leaks, which can negate the benefits of double glazing.
    • Service warranty: Look for a credible installer who uses a thorough service warranty on both the product and the setup.
  3. Kinds Of Double Glazing

    • Products: Double glazing can be made from different products, consisting of uPVC, wood, and aluminum. Each material has its own benefits and downsides, so it's essential to select one that matches your needs and aesthetic choices.
    • Gas Filling: The area between the panes can be filled with air or a gas like argon, which offers much better insulation. Argon-filled windows are more energy-efficient but might come at a greater cost.
  4. Looks

    • Design and Style: Double glazing can be personalized to match the design of your home. Whether you prefer a modern or conventional look, there are choices readily available to suit your taste.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: How much can I minimize my energy costs with double glazing?

  • A: The specific savings can vary depending on the size of your home and the performance of your existing windows. Nevertheless, the Energy Saving Trust approximates that a common semi-detached house can conserve approximately ₤ 110 annually on heating expenses with double glazing.

Q: Does double glazing require upkeep?

  • A: Double glazing requires minimal upkeep. Routine cleaning of the aluminium windows luton and frames is suggested to keep them in excellent condition. It's also crucial to look for any signs of damage or wear and tear, which can be dealt with immediately.

Q: Can double glazing be set up in older homes?

  • A: Yes, double glazing can be installed in older homes. Nevertheless, it's important to choose a style that complements the existing architecture and fulfills any sanctuary or listed structure regulations.

Q: What should I try to find in a Double Glazing Luton glazing installer?

  • A: Look for a business that is FENSA (Fenestration Self-Assessment Scheme) registered, which ensures that the installer fulfills high requirements of quality and safety. Furthermore, check for customer reviews and testimonials to determine the reliability and professionalism of the installer.

Q: Are there any federal government plans to help with the cost of double glazing?

  • A: While there are no specific federal government schemes for double glazing, some local councils and energy companies might provide grants or discount rates for energy-efficient home enhancements. It's worth talking to your regional council or energy supplier for any offered help.
